Output 58a0c64a11333ab0e04db9e424a53e176cbb68c97b326d125afd7293790b571f:1

value
1147642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4273256ec1c4822c596a4f38e642687edbdb885 OP_EQUAL
address
3GeyhS8kCW5jDtL25HQa5a1a77rcHd6f8S
transaction
58a0c64a11333ab0e04db9e424a53e176cbb68c97b326d125afd7293790b571f
spent
true